Sidewalk cementing services involve the installation, repair, and reinforcement of concrete walkways and pathways around residential and commercial properties. This process typically includes preparing the ground, pouring fresh concrete, and finishing the surface to create a smooth, durable pathway. Skilled contractors may also handle tasks such as leveling uneven surfaces, removing old or damaged concrete, and ensuring proper drainage. The goal is to establish a safe, attractive, and long-lasting walkway that enhances the property's overall appearance and functionality.

These services are especially useful for addressing common problems like cracked, uneven, or crumbling sidewalks that can pose safety hazards or detract from curb appeal. Over time, exposure to weather, shifting soil, or heavy foot traffic can cause concrete to deteriorate. Repairing or replacing damaged sections helps prevent trips and falls, reduces the risk of further structural issues, and maintains the property's value. For property owners noticing signs of wear or instability in their walkways, professional cementing services provide a reliable solution.

The overview below groups typical Sidewalk Cementing proj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Springfield, MO.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or sidewalk cement repairs gener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ine fixes, such as patching cracks or small sections, fall within this middle range. Fewer projects tend to push into the higher end of this spectrum.

Surface Resurfacing - Resurfacing or re-coating sidewalks usually costs between $1,000 and $2,500 for most residential projects. Larger or more detailed resurfacing jobs can reach $3,000 or more, depending on the scope.

Full Replacement - Replacing an entire sidewalk can cost from $4,000 to $8,000 or higher for typical residential properties. Larger, more complex projects, such as commercial sidewalks or extensive replacements, may exceed $10,000.

Custom or Decorative Work - Installing decorative or stamped concrete sidewalks often ranges from $3,000 to $7,000. These projects are less common and tend to fall into the higher end of the typical cost spectrum based on design complexity.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

Clear, written expectations are essential when comparing local contractors for sidewalk cementing. Homeowners should seek detailed estimates that outline the scope of work, materials to be used, and specific responsibilities of each party. Having this information in writing helps prevent misunderstandings and provides a basis for comparing proposals objectively. It’s also helpful to clarify the process, from preparation to finishing, so that expectations are aligned and there are no surprises once the project begins.

What are the benefits of sidewalk cementing services? Sidewalk cementing can improve safety, enhance curb appeal, and provide a durable surface for pedestrian use in your neighborhood or property.

How do local contractors prepare for sidewalk cementing projects? Contractors typically evaluate the site, clear the area, and ensure proper grading and base preparation before pouring and finishing the cement.

Can sidewalk cementing be customized to match existing walkways? Yes, many service providers offer options for finishes, patterns, and colors to coordinate with existing surfaces or personal preferences.

What types of cement are used for sidewalk projects? Standard concrete mixes are commonly used, with options for additional reinforcement or specific formulations based on the project’s needs.
